Comfort

A sectional sleeper sofa lets you to create a sleeping space that's easy to convert when guests come to visit. It can also add a touch chic to your living room. It can be used as a comfortable space to read, relax or watch TV. Adding throw pillows and other decorations helps elevate the look. Select furniture that matches your decor.

These sectional sofas have the sleeping surface built into their frames, which is different from traditional pull-out couches, which have an additional bed. The hidden bed is usually an queen-sized mattress, however some models come with twin mattresses or trundles. Make sure the model you pick has a bed that can be closed and opened without difficulty.

Some sleeper sofas with sectional design have a storage area under the chaise lounge, in which you can store bedding for guests staying over. This is a great place for keeping sheets, blankets and pillows. Certain sectional sleepers feature adjustable headrests to give you more comfort. Certain sectional sleepers come with recliners to make it more comfortable for you to unwind.

A sectional sleeper sofa of high-quality has mattresses made from durable materials. You can choose from memory foam, polyurethane foam, or innerspring mattresses. Memory foam offers relief from pressure points and contouring. Polyurethane is a firm material and is inexpensive. Innerspring mattresses are comfortable and offer support. Latex mattresses are eco-friendly and have a more bouncier feel than memory foam or polyurethane foam. You can test out the different types of mattresses in the furniture store to find which one is the most comfortable for you.

Convenience

If you are looking for a sectional sofa that can sleep two, consider features such as hidden storage, power recline and a comfortable bed mechanism. It is also advisable to consider material types that are stain-resistant, like linen or high-performance microfiber. If you're concerned about spills and stains, go for a model that comes with removable slipcovers that ease cleaning.

Choose a sectional bed with a futon mattress or memory foam mattress, or innerspring mattresses depending on your comfort preference and budget. A memory foam mattress feels more comfortable and contouring, while an innerspring mattress provides bounce and support. Try each mattress in a store to determine which one feels the best and is suitable for your space.

Some sectional sofas convert into beds using a pull-out ottoman or some other hidden mechanism, while others--such as the Milo Sleeper from Raymour and Flanigan, have a built-in platform that doubles as an extension bed. This unique design provides guests with a spacious, comfortable place to sit down. A side table is also provided for their belongings.

When you are choosing a sleeper sectional choose one that is able to accommodate the number of guests you typically seat at family gatherings and social events. The majority of models have capacity of between three and five people, however larger models can hold more.

If you're working on a tight budget, you should consider furniture that comes with a futon sectional sleeper or a queen-sized sleeper chaise. Find a modular sleeper sectional with the option of a reversible seat or parts that are interchangeable to add seats as your family grows. When selecting a sectional, you should keep the size of your room and any existing furniture. Emily Roose is a luxury interior designer at Emily Roose Interiors. She recommends that you leave 3 feet between your sofa and a taller piece furniture, or if it's placed next to the coffee table.
